/************** menu langues **************/

ul#langues { float:right; margin-right:5px; padding-top:45px;}
ul#langues li { display:inline; padding:0 2px; }
ul#langues li a {}

/***************menu pied **************/
ul#menu-pied {float:left; text-align:left; margin-right:12px; }
ul#menu-pied li {display:inline;  border-right:1px solid #c6c1ba; padding:0 12px;}

/************** menu outils **************/

ul#outils {text-align:left; }
ul#outils li {display:inline; border-right:1px solid #3f3f3f; padding:0 12px;}
ul#outils li.last {border:0;}
ul#outils li a {color:#3f3f3f;}
ul#outils li a:hover {color:#ef4909;}


/************** menu principal **************/

/* Masquer les niveaux 2 et plus */
ul#navigation, #navigation ul, #navigation li { margin:0; padding: 0; }
ul#navigation {width:1000px; height:32px; background:transparent url(../images/menu_bg_ul.gif) no-repeat scroll left top;}
#navigation li {float:left; height:23px; padding:8px 10px 0; margin-top:1px; border-right:1px solid #adacac; text-transform:uppercase; font-size:0.8em; }
#navigation li.last {border-right:0; }
/*#navigation ul ul { display: none !important; } */
#navigation li.select ul { display: block !important; }
#navigation li.select ul ul { display: none !important; }
#navigation li.select ul li.select ul { display: block !important; }

/* 1e niveau */
#navigation li.questions-reponses {border:none; }
#navigation li.contact {border-left:5px solid #f39042; width:174px; float:right;}
#navigation li a {color:#313437; }
#navigation li a:hover, #navigation li a.aselect { color:#ef4909;}

/*****************Sous NAV****************/
ul.sousnav {clear:both; width:997px; margin:0 auto; height:32px; background:#85827D; border-bottom:1px solid #fff;}
ul.sousnav li {float:left; height:22px; text-align:center; padding:8px 12px 0; border-right:1px solid #fff;  margin-top:1px;  text-transform:uppercase; font-size:0.8em;}
ul.sousnav li.last {border-right:0; }

ul.sousnav li a {color:#fff;}

ul.sousnav li a:hover, ul.sousnav li a.aselect {color:#313437;}

ul.sousnav li ul {display:none;}

/******************Sous menu Piscine *****************/
ul.sousnav li.piscine-filtration-compacte {width:140px; padding:2px 3px 0; height:28px;}
ul.sousnav li.piscine-mur-filtrant {width:101px; padding:2px 3px 0; height:28px;}
ul.sousnav li.piscine-classique {width:88px; padding:2px 3px 0; height:28px;}
ul.sousnav li.piscine-debordement {width:113px; padding:2px 3px 0; height:28px;}
ul.sousnav li.piscine-miroir {width:66px; padding:2px 3px 0; height:28px;}
ul.sousnav li.piscine-wellness-zen {width:106px; padding:2px 3px 0; height:28px;}
ul.sousnav li.piscine-collectivites {width:105px; padding:2px 3px 0; height:28px;}
ul.sousnav li.piscine-hors-sol {width:82px; padding:2px 3px 0; height:28px;}
ul.sousnav li.options {display:none; }
ul.sousnav li.renovation {border:none; padding:8px 3px 0; padding-left:10px;}




/* 3e niveau */
#navigation li li ul {  }
#navigation li li li a:hover, #navigation li li li a.aselect { }
